Output 81d1161b77d34196523d4a3c3233cc1508354cb03073763136c690c45ca82586:9

value
335000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c181227747bfef54aaefd092832d3cf117fd4c43 OP_EQUAL
address
3KLB2zsXBNrhsQpt5pzFSQ6FnnZoFwhSc2
transaction
81d1161b77d34196523d4a3c3233cc1508354cb03073763136c690c45ca82586
spent
true